Diverse Sources Interview
1. The University had a record enrollment of 35,568 students last year and is expected to have a record again this year. How has this increased enrollment affected you?
 Texas State University’s increased enrollment has not (negatively) affected me. I have noticed a few things like increased construction on campus, larger classes, and just generally a larger amount of people on campus
2. Should the University continue to grow?
I think that Texas State University should continue to grow as long as the administrators and professors are able to accommodate the growth and are still able to adequately meet student’s needs.
3. What do you mean by "student needs"?
If the student body is growing, then the professors are going to need to be held to a higher expectation and there need to be more of them.
4. Did the size of the University influence your decision to come here?
Yes the size of the university definitely influenced my decision to come here. I was looking for a University that had a large enrollment but still had the feel of a smaller campus or university.
